WIP My Hero Academia Fighting Game Credits: Building: TokuStudios [Owner] VFX: bardok20005 Modeling: DJDDANYAlt [Co-Owner] Animation: Pikachu_BrosYT Project: Heroes is a work-in-progress fighting game that functions off of a permanent-death mechanic, meaning that if you die three times, you will recieve a different clan and quirk. Will you become a Hero, and protect the world? Or will you become a Villain, and live to destroy it all? W = Sprint M1 = Standard Attack M2 = Heavy Attack V = Carry T = Grip Q = Dash
